With the Mobile infantry, The five pointed star is a military sign used by several nations in different colours- if you set the civ colour to white for example, you have an american Truck, set it to green and you can't see the star at all.
With the harrier Just change the INI file, Delete the text next to the RUN entry and replace it with the text next to the DEFAULT entry- and there you have it, a harrier that just flies straight.
